Simple and Genuine Appreciation Messages

Starting with straightforward and heartfelt messages is always a great choice. These are perfect for everyday moments when you want to recognize your boss’s support without being too elaborate.

They work well in emails, quick notes, or casual conversations, showing your appreciation in an easy, relatable way.

Use these messages to remind your boss that their efforts don’t go unnoticed and that you truly value their guidance.

1. “Thank you for always being there when I need guidance.” – A simple way to acknowledge your boss’s consistent support.

2. “Your encouragement means a lot to me, and I’m grateful to have you as my leader.” – Perfect for expressing gratitude for motivation and leadership.

3. “I appreciate your patience and understanding in every challenge.” – Highlights your boss’s empathy and calm approach.

4. “Thanks for trusting me with important tasks and believing in my abilities.” – Shows appreciation for confidence in your work.

5. “Your support makes even the toughest days manageable.” – Acknowledges how their backing helps during difficult times.

6. “I’m thankful for your open-door policy and willingness to listen.” – Appreciates their accessibility and approachability.

7. “Working under your leadership has been a rewarding experience.” – A formal yet warm way to appreciate their management style.

8. “You inspire me to grow and improve every day.” – Recognizes their positive influence on your personal development.

9. “Thank you for creating such a supportive and positive work environment.” – Praises their efforts in fostering a great workplace.

10. “Your feedback is always constructive and helps me do better.” – Highlights their helpfulness in guiding your progress.

11. “I’m grateful for the opportunities you’ve given me to learn and succeed.” – Shows appreciation for growth chances.

12. “Thanks for being patient with me as I navigate new responsibilities.” – Acknowledges their understanding during your learning curve.

13. “Your leadership style brings out the best in our team.” – Compliments their ability to motivate and unite.

14. “I appreciate how you recognize and celebrate our achievements.” – Notes their acknowledgment of hard work.

15. “Thank you for always being fair and considerate.” – Praises their just and kind nature.

16. “Your support has made a big difference in my career.” – Emphasizes long-term impact.

17. “I admire your dedication and commitment to our success.” – Highlights their hard work and passion.

18. “Thanks for being a mentor I can always count on.” – Shows gratitude for guidance beyond management.

19. “Your confidence in me motivates me to push harder.” – Expresses how their belief encourages your efforts.

20. “I appreciate your kindness and professionalism every day.” – A balanced compliment that covers character and work ethic.
